accessory center.desktop bridge.device service.exe freezing MS teams application.

When I use the Microsoft Modern Wireless Headset 8JR-00001 with MS Teams call it freezes the MS teams application. I unplug the USB receiver that it comes with then re-plug it into the computer then it works. I have tried the following as a work around:

When I got to the Microsoft accessory center I reset the headset to factory default and it resolves some of issues that were reported.

The other fix I have found is to connect the headset via Bluetooth

please let me know if anyone else has had this issue.

I am starting to look at this application : accessory center.desktop bridge.device service.exe
to see if this has something to do with this.

What has not worked is : removing MS teams and clearing out all folders that have files after the uninstall of the MS teams APP.
I opened a new box and got a new headset and that still didnt work.
*******************************************************************************UPDATE Aug 2023*******************************************************
For my environment the issue has now gone away with Microsoft sending the update to our tenant. For each user that was using the work around (Bluetooth or a different brand of headset) the dongle is now working once again. If your org still is having issue please open a formal ticket using with the Admin for of the Microsoft Teams. Then I would refer them to this thread for support.
